添加收藏夹  设为首页  深圳服务热线:13751165337  13692101218
51电子网联系电话:13751165337
位置:首页 > IC型号导航 > 首字符A型号页 > 首字符A的型号第990页 > AT89C51RC > AT89C51RC PDF资料 > AT89C51RC PDF资料1第12页
定时器0和1
定时器2
定时器0和定时器1的AT89C51RC的操作方式相同的定时器0和1
在AT89C51和AT89C52 。
定时器2是一个16位定时器/计数器,可以作为定时器或事件计数器。
操作的类型被选中位的C / T2在SFR T2CON (见表2)。
定时器2有三种工作模式:捕捉,自动重装(向上或向下计数) ,并
波特率发生器。该模式由位T2CON中选择,如表3所示。
定时器2由两个8位寄存器, TH2和TL2 。在定时器功能中, TL2稳压
存器递增每个机器周期。由于一个机器周期包含12
振荡周期,计数率是振荡器频率的1/12 。
表3中。
定时器2的工作模式
RCLK + TCLK
0
0
1
X
CP/RL2
0
1
X
X
TR2
1
1
1
0
模式
16位自动重装
16位捕捉
波特率发生器
(关闭)
在计数器功能时,寄存器递增响应1到0的跳变时
其对应的外部输入引脚, T2 。在此函数中,外部输入进行采样
在每个机器周期的S5P2 。当样品显示出高的在一个周期内和一
低在下一周期中,计数增加。新的计数值出现在稳压
存器中循环的S3P1期间以下其中的过渡中检测到1 。
由于两个机器周期( 24个振荡周期)需要识别1到0的转录
习得,最大计数率是振荡器频率的1/24 。以保证一个给定的
电平进行采样的至少一次改变之前,所述电平应保持在至少一个
完整的机器周期。
捕捉模式
在拍摄模式下,两个选项的EXEN2位T2CON中选择。如果EXEN2 = 0 ,
定时器2是一个16位定时器或计数器溢出时套在T2CON中的TF2 。该位
然后可以用来产生中断。如果EXEN2 = 1 ,定时器2执行相同
的操作,但有1到0的外部输入T2EX过渡也导致在当前值
TH2和TL2被分别捕捉到RCAP2H和RCAP2L 。此外,该
在T2EX的跳变位EXF2 T2CON中进行设置。该EXF2位,就像TF2 ,可以
产生一个中断。捕获模式示于图2 。
定时器2可以被编程为向上或向下计数时,在其16位的自动配置
重装模式。此功能是由DCEN (向下计数使能)位位于调用
SFR的T2MOD (见表4) 。复位时, DCEN位被设置为0 ,这样定时器2
默认为向上计数。当DCEN被置位,定时器2向上或向下计数,这取决于
在T2EX引脚的值。
自动加载(向上或
向下计数器)
12
AT89C51RC
1920B–MICRO–11/02

深圳市碧威特网络技术有限公司